Does anyone know of any organizations that will provide grant money for shelters for the use of purchasing equipment/supplies specifically for emergencies or disasters? We're updating our shelter disaster/emergency plan and have come to the conclusion that we don't have many items that would be helpful or necessary in the event of an emergency and thought maybe a grant would help us purchase those items. I've done some research and there are some general grants that might work, but thought I'd check to see if anyone knew of any for the items we're looking for.

The best advice I can give you on this is get in touch with you Local Emergency Manager. They can apply for grant money from Homeland Security for disaster preparedness. You have to go through the local EM because they are the only ones that can apply for these grants.

I know that PetSmart Charities (see their website) has grant monies that you can apply for. They divide the nation into 2 filing dates. They also have Webinars (online classes) that are terrific in HOW to apply, and other helpful topics. Check out the site.
